Strain modulation of optical f-f transitions of lanthanide ions

Description

A resonant strain modulation technique has been used to measure the shifts of the optical transitions within the shielded 4f shell of lanthanide ions. The experimental technique and its limitations are described. The accuracy of the method was evaluated by measurements on crystals, CaF2:Sm2+ and SrF2:Sm2+, for which static shifts with strain have been reported. The shifts of vibronic sidebands for these materials were investigated. Experimental data for Er3+ and Pr3+ ions in CaF2 and SrF2 lattices are presented. (author)
